Quick Summary

The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Land and Maritime has issued a presolicitation for BATTERY BOXES (NSN 6160015213064) under solicitation number SPE7LX-26-R-0073. This is a Total Small Business Set-Aside. The government intends to solicit and contract with only approved sources (specifically MOLDTRONICS INC, CAGE 25435, P/N 987-6641-001) due to a lack of complete, unrestrictive technical data, as authorized by 10 U.S.C. 2304(c)(1). However, all responsible sources may submit an offer for consideration. Market research documents are available to gather information for a future Indefinite Quantity Contract (IQC or LTC).

Scope of Work

This acquisition is for the supply of BATTERY BOXES (NSN 6160015213064), with an estimated annual demand of 1782 units. The required delivery schedule is 135 days. This procurement includes a family group of items within Federal Supply Class 6160. Specifications, plans, or drawings are not available.

Evaluation

While price will be a significant factor, the final award decision will be based on a combination of price, delivery, past performance, and other evaluation factors as detailed in the forthcoming solicitation. This acquisition is subject to the Trade Agreements Act of 1979.
